When an error is detected in the hardware function test, the HDD posts the CHECK
CONDITION status for all I/O operation request except the REQUEST SENSE command.
The error status is not cleared even if the error information (sense data) is read. Only
when the power is turned off or re-turned on, the status can be cleared. When this status is
cleared, the HDD executes the initial self-diagnostics again (see item (1)).
Refer to Subsection 4.4.1 "SEND DIAGNOSTIC (1D)" of the Interface Specifications for
further details of the command specifications.

Test programs

The basic operations of the HDD itself can be checked with the self-diagnostic function. However,
to check general operations such as the host system and interface operations in a status similar to
the normal operation status, a test program that runs on the host system must be used.
The structure and functions of the test program depend on the user system requirements. Generally,
it is recommended to provide a general input/output test program that includes devices connected to
the input/output devices on other I/O ports.
Including the following test items in the test program is recommended to test the HDD functions
generally.
(1)
Interface (loop) test
The operations of the data buffer on the HDD are checked with the WRITE BUFFER and READ
BUFFER commands.
(2)
Basic operation test
The basic operations of the HDD are checked by executing self-diagnosis with the SEND
DIAGNOSTIC command (see Subsection 6.1.1).
(3)
Random/sequential read test
The positioning (seek) operation and read operation are tested in random access and sequential
access modes with the READ, READ EXTENDED, or VERIFY command.
